Product Description

by Paul E. Krajewski (Author), Matthew N. Topper (Author)

Whats in Your Car uses a combination of catchy poems and interesting pictures to explore how elements of the periodic table are used to make a car. Thirty-one different elements are shown with captivating pictures of the raw materials and their application in the vehicle. The uses of these materials are explained with simple poems that can serve as a starting point for deeper exploration into the world of materials and automobiles. Whats in Your Car appeals to children of all ages as they understand how different materials come together to create awesome automobiles.

Author Biography

Paul Krajewski is a husband, dad, materials scientist, inventor, and die-hard wolverine. He is currently the director of Vehicle Systems Research at General Motors Company.

Matt Topper is a husband, dad, teacher, coach, and die-hard Spartan. He is currently a social studies teacher at Oak Valley Middle School and spent his first sixteen years teaching fifth grade at Heritage Elementary.
